Each
 * batch copies at most this many rows from the legacy table into the
 * shadow table while dual-writes remain active. Keeping the batch small
 * bounds lock duration and ensures replication lag on the Vessing cluster
 * stays under our alerting threshold. Do not raise this without re-running
 * the contention analysis; larger batches have historically caused write
 * stalls during cutover. The value below was validated under the following
 * migration build.
 */

build token for kagaf-hahof: htk14_9d3d4d26d7d8de

- [ ] Step 7: Archive cold storage buckets (Glacierline tier). Confirm both ceremony witnesses are present, verify bucket manifests match the Oxbow ledger, then seal the archive key shares. Plugin authors may observe but not handle shares. Once sealed, the archive index itself is encrypted and can only be reopened with the passphrase below.

vault phrase of badup-hahig = tamael-aldael-kelmir-istael-fenok-istwyn-tamius-jorath-oliion

Meeting notes — Verlane Property Transfer, excerpt. Attendees agreed the notarised deed for the Orchard Bay parcel is now complete and countersigned by the notary at Quillstone & Marr. The office manager will keep the deed in the fire safe overnight, logged in the custody book with time in and time out. Tomorrow it travels by bonded courier to the Fennick Registry office; no photocopies are to leave the building. Before dispatch, the courier must be given the confidential hand-over instruction below.

courier memo of tawep-tajep: the quenius ulaiel courier leaves the fenir ledger at gate 9128 under passcode 527513

## Ticket: Config drift on spool-runner nodes

Plugin authors: the Quillpress spooler microservice has drifted from its declared baseline on three of five nodes. Retry limits, queue depth, and driver timeouts all differ, which explains intermittent job loss reported against third-party render plugins. Do not hardcode workarounds in your plugins; we are restoring the canonical config this week. Until then, test only against nodes spool-a and spool-b. The canonical values every node will converge to are listed below.

service settings:
[raldor]
team = prawyn
access_code = ac_7ea342
owner = lamvan.sorael
host = raldor.ordinsys.corp
port = 8000
peer = goriel.sivreltech.example
salt = cf3b27b3
pin = 2041